Advantages and Disadvantages of "Unlimited" Data Plans
Advantages | Disadvantages |
---|---|
Peace of mind, no more data anxiety | Potential for throttling after a certain usage limit |
Freedom to stream, browse, and download to your heart's content | May be more expensive than limited data plans |
No surprise overage charges | "Unlimited" may come with caveats and fair usage policies |
